Akali Dal sources told NDTV that Sukhbir Badal has suffered an injury on his hand, but it is not life threatening. He is being treated at a private hospital in Nanded.
Shiromani Akali Dal president Sukhbir Singh Badal was attacked with a kirpan at a Nanded gurdwara. A police inspector sustained injuries while protecting Badal during the religious visit. Badal suffered a hand injury and was taken for medical treatment. Security personnel intervened and overpowered the attacker at the scene. Police have launched an investigation into the motive and circumstances of the incident.
Sukhbir Singh Badal was attacked while he was walking towards the langar hall after paying obeisance at the gurdwara.
